Bang, crash, wallop.....
Hi all,

Been meaning to ask this on here to see if anyone else has the same....

My 110, whenever I go over pot hole/speed bump etc makes a really noticable 'rattle' from somewhere underneath at the rear. It's a bit like a tin tray being dropped...

I've had a 110 300tdi before and didnt have such a noise. I'm planning on getting under there asap to have a look around but if anyone can shed some light on what it could be, it would be appreciated. Cheers,

Its the rear brake pads rattling in the calipers. I'm on my second puma now, the first one did it - dealers changed pads and calipers - still the same, in the end they welded a small blob on to the back of the pads and that stopped it -
3 years later another new 110 and the pads are rattling again - dealers had it in twice to cure it - each time they say its been fixed, but off course they haven't cured it.

You can tell by going over the same bump with the brake lightly pressed - no rattle.

every 110 puma i see makes the same rattle.

My Puma's rear brakes rattled too. Solved the problem by fitting another spring to the retaining pins between the pin head and the caliper body . This added greater tension against the pin because thats what was rattling.

All of my Defenders seem to do this if the backs of the pads are dry. I'm always generous with the copper slip both on the pins and on the back of the pads which helps it stick to the piston and retract. 90XS Tdci John Eales
